FDA said its environmental samples found the two outbreak strains of Salmonella both of which were indistinguishable from the strains that sickened victims on the farm. And the Kentucky Department of Health, investigating the deaths, found one of the strains on a Chamberlain cantaloupe collected from a retail store.
